Building codes and regulations are essential parts of the development trade, serving as a framework for safety, quality, and sustainability. These codes are established to protect public well being and safety, guaranteeing that building initiatives adhere to minimum standards. For development contractors, familiarity with these codes is non-negotiable, as compliance can significantly influence the success of a project.


Each area or municipality has its personal set of constructing codes and regulations, shaped by native conditions, local weather, and specific group needs. Contractors have to be diligent in understanding these necessities to avoid costly penalties, delays, or legal disputes. Ignorance of native codes can result in unpermitted work, which not only compromises the integrity of a project however can also endanger the lives of those who occupy the space.


Zoning laws play an important position in construction rules, dictating land use and the types of constructions that can be constructed specifically zones. Understanding zoning ordinances ensures that contractors construct in compliance with local insurance policies, which can limit certain actions or building sorts in specific areas. Failing to think about zoning rules would possibly lead to fines or the demolition of unauthorized buildings.


Permitting is another very important area in the realm of construction codes. Most tasks would require permits before the commencement of any work. This typically entails submitting plans to local authorities who will evaluate them for compliance with relevant codes. Permits aren't just bureaucratic hurdles; they be sure that skilled eyes evaluate the plans and that safety measures are in place.

Fire security codes should not be overlooked, as they're among the many most important rules. These codes handle how buildings must be constructed to reduce the chance of fireside and ensure adequate egress in emergencies. Contractors ought to pay consideration to the specifics concerning materials, sprinkler systems, and exit routes. Non-compliance can have devastating consequences, both by means of legal responsibility and public security (Home Restoration Los Angeles).

Accessibility regulations, such as these outlined in the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A), are crucial for ensuring that every one buildings are accessible to individuals with disabilities. Contractors want to include features like ramps, elevators, and accessible restrooms into their projects. Failing to fulfill these standards can lead to authorized repercussions and can also alienate potential clients and prospects.


Environmental regulations have become more and more essential in recent decades. Many regions implement codes that require sustainable practices through the development process and stipulate the power effectivity of buildings. Contractors should stay up to date on rules regarding waste administration, emissions, and the utilization of environmentally friendly supplies. Compliance not only satisfies legal obligations however also can improve a contractor's popularity and marketability. Bathroom Remodeling Contractor Los Angeles.

Structural codes are paramount, especially in areas vulnerable to pure disasters like earthquakes, floods, or hurricanes. Building codes dictate how structures should be designed and built to face up to these occasions. Contractors should ensure they are conversant in local structural necessities, as non-adherence can result in catastrophic failures and severe legal responsibility points.

  • Understand the International Building Code (IBC) to ensure compliance with security and structural requirements across numerous project varieties.

  • Familiarize your self with local zoning laws that govern land use, density, and building peak restrictions to keep away from legal issues.

  • Review hearth security rules, including alarm methods and sprinkler necessities, to guard occupants and property.

  • Be conscious of accessibility regulations like the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) to create inclusive environments for all users.

  • Know the National Electrical Code (NEC) for protected electrical installations and preventing potential hazards in your initiatives.

  • Stay knowledgeable about environmental rules concerning waste management, water usage, and conservation practices to promote sustainability.

  • Keep up with well being and sanitation codes associated to plumbing and waste disposal to make sure secure residing situations.

  • Recognize the significance of energy conservation codes that require adherence to energy-efficient building practices and technologies.

  • Engage with native historic preservation codes if working in designated districts to maintain the integrity of culturally vital buildings.

How do I find the constructing codes applicable to my project?




Building codes can typically be found by way of local authorities websites or constructing departments. It's essential to seek the advice of your municipality’s laws, as codes can vary considerably from one location to a different and may be up to date frequently.


What are the implications of not following building codes?


Failing to stick to building codes can lead to authorized motion, fines, delays in project completion, and in severe instances, can result in structural failure or safety hazards. It's essential for contractors to prioritize compliance to avoid critical repercussions.

Are constructing codes the same everywhere?


No, building codes differ by jurisdiction. Local and state laws can dictate specific requirements based on regional components corresponding to local weather, inhabitants density, and safety concerns. Always verify local codes on your specific space.

Is it possible to attraction a building code violation?


Yes, if a contractor receives a constructing code violation, they'll usually appeal the citation through the local constructing division or a chosen board. Each jurisdiction has its personal course of, and contractors should put together a clear case and provide any needed documentation to help their attraction.
